An Isosceles triangle is a type of triangle in geometry that has two sides of equal length.
From the figure attached, triangle STR has two sides of equal length which are;
1.) ST and
2.) TR
The two equal sides (ST and TR) are called legs while the third side is called the base of the triangle.

Answer: 300*0.73^x
Step-by-step explanation:
300 is the initial value and every time x goes up by 1, the value get multiplied by 0.73
when x=3
then the value would be 300*0.73*0.73*0.73 or 300*0.73^3
then for x amount of times the equation would be 300*(0.73 x times ) or 300*0.73^x
